Output 85fa79a334c23e1bd05dd7544e3bbca6f4e1f77d5e2dc9d1061d76f74fb8a232:3

value
5671662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d24f4a9a2060e71c43ba044e024415a40b64146 OP_EQUAL
address
3ABX37SuJgaM6PoeZXqE4qLKBxEJj8ThqP
transaction
85fa79a334c23e1bd05dd7544e3bbca6f4e1f77d5e2dc9d1061d76f74fb8a232
confirmations
317193
spent
true